无法抓取wp最近的帖子主题Sql错误

时间:2015-08-25 14:28:32

标签: php wordpress

错误是

  

警告:mysql_query():第11行/home/lekalic/public_html/latest_new.php中的用户'lekalic'@'localhost'(使用密码:NO)拒绝访问

     

警告:mysql_query():无法在第11行的/home/lekalic/public_html/latest_new.php中建立指向服务器的链接

     

警告:mysql_fetch_array()要求参数1为资源,布尔值在第12行的/home/lekalic/public_html/latest_new.php中给出

1 个答案:

答案 0 :(得分:0)

在检索任何数据之前,您需要连接到数据库:

$username = "username";
$password = "password";
$hostname = "localhost"; 

//connection to the database
$dbhandle = mysql_connect($hostname, $username, $password)
 or die("Unable to connect to MySQL");

//select a database to work with
$selected = mysql_select_db("databasename",$dbhandle)
  or die("Could not select examples");

//execute the SQL query and return records
$result = mysql_query("SELECT * FROM 'wp_posts' WHERE post_status='publish' ORDER BY ID DESC LIMIT $number");

while ($row = mysql_fetch_array($result)) {
    //do stuff
}

mysql_close($dbhandle);